Annotated Snippet
#ifndef _NET_BATMAN_ADV_BLA_H_
#define _NET_BATMAN_ADV_BLA_H_
#include "main.h"
#include <linux/compiler.h>
#include <linux/netdevice.h>
#include <linux/netlink.h>
#include <linux/skbuff.h>
#include <linux/stddef.h>
#include <linux/types.h>
/**
* batadv_bla_is_loopdetect_mac() - check if the mac address is from a loop
* detect frame sent by bridge loop avoidance
* @mac: mac address to check
*
* Return: true if it looks like a loop detect frame
* (mac starts with BA:BE), false otherwise
*/
static inline bool batadv_bla_is_loopdetect_mac(const uint8_t *mac)
{
if (mac[0] == 0xba && mac[1] == 0xbe)
return true;
return false;
}
#ifdef CONFIG_BATMAN_ADV_BLA
bool batadv_bla_rx(struct batadv_priv *bat_priv, struct sk_buff *skb,
unsigned short vid, int packet_type);
bool batadv_bla_tx(struct batadv_priv *bat_priv, struct sk_buff *skb,
unsigned short vid);
bool batadv_bla_is_backbone_gw(struct sk_buff *skb,
struct batadv_orig_node *orig_node,
int hdr_size);
int batadv_bla_claim_dump(struct sk_buff *msg, struct netlink_callback *cb);
int batadv_bla_backbone_dump(struct sk_buff *msg, struct netlink_callback *cb);
bool batadv_bla_is_backbone_gw_orig(struct batadv_priv *bat_priv, u8 *orig,
unsigned short vid);
bool batadv_bla_check_bcast_duplist(struct batadv_priv *bat_priv,
struct sk_buff *skb);
void batadv_bla_update_orig_address(struct batadv_priv *bat_priv,
struct batadv_hard_iface *primary_if,
struct batadv_hard_iface *oldif);
void batadv_bla_status_update(struct net_device *net_dev);
int batadv_bla_init(struct batadv_priv *bat_priv);
void batadv_bla_free(struct batadv_priv *bat_priv);
#ifdef CONFIG_BATMAN_ADV_DAT
bool batadv_bla_check_claim(struct batadv_priv *bat_priv, u8 *addr,
unsigned short vid);
#endif
#define BATADV_BLA_CRC_INIT 0
